Found more drift on Pressley's checkout load tests — staging and perf are running different connection pool sizes again, so last night's numbers for the Cartwheel flow are basically useless. Pretty sure someone hand-edited perf after the Tuesday incident and never backported it. Can we agree at the sync that perf is the source of truth? For reference, here's what perf is actually running right now.

settings of bahop-kaweg:
[novael]
host = novael.braskstack.example
user = novael_svc
database = novael_prod

Gatewarden enforces request quotas per tenant on the Ostrel platform. Defaults are 1,000 requests per minute; premium tiers vary. When a tenant hits their quota, they receive throttling responses — this is expected behavior, not an outage. Do not raise quotas directly in production; changes go through the quota-change workflow with approval from the Ostrel capacity team. Temporary bumps expire after 24 hours automatically. The quota tiers, override procedure, and approval steps are documented on the internal page below.

operations page: https://jira.qorvelsys.internal/browse/pages/browse/pages

Handover: shrinkctl (batch image resizer CLI)

For review before the Quillmere audit. shrinkctl resizes uploaded imagery in batches for the Asterholt media pipeline. Runs as a cron job on two workers, no network listeners. Input paths are sanitized in resize/paths.go; the EXIF stripper is on by default. Known gaps: no checksum verification on source files, and temp dirs are world-readable on the older worker. Output bucket credentials come from the vault sidecar. Runtime configuration as currently deployed follows.

settings of yahag-yafog:
[pramir]
host = pramir.qirvancorp.internal
user = pramir_svc
database = pramir_prod

### Step 4: Resolve the calendar sync conflict

Okay, this is the fiddly bit. When Planloom 3 syncs against the legacy Daybreak calendar, overlapping events get duplicated because both sides think they own the record. The fix: run the dedupe script *before* enabling two-way sync, then set the `sync_authority` flag to `planloom` for every migrated tenant. Don't skip the dry run — it prints exactly which events would merge. The script needs direct access to the sync database, using the connection string below.

replica DSN, kajep-yahag: mssql://praok_svc:iF@db-8d68.plorvaio.local:5432/eliion